got a bacon egg & cheese on a roll a few weeks ago at Luscious Market Deli. typically i associate a good bacon egg & cheese sandwich with gritty hole-in-the-wall bodegas and corner stores in nyc…memories are a helluva drug when it comes to food or just about anything. anyway Luscious Market Deli is not gritty or a hole-in-the-wall store…it’s a newish clean brightly lit deli / convenience store with a lot of pre-prepared food options, a variety of salad and hot/cold sandwich options, snacks, drinks and more. the bacon egg & cheese is made to order, of course—warm fluffy toasted roll sandwiching salt-n-peppered eggs, crispy bacon, melty Americano cheese and a touch of ketchup! took my breakfast to one of the many East Village garden-y seating areas and enjoyed the sandwich in the shade. it’s sometimes a thing as simple as a warm sandwich, good weather, and a breeze that foretells that the rest of the day is going to be just as good. anyway, the deli is a solid option for food and it does have a few seats by the window and on the sidewalk if you just want to eat immediately. the staff is friendly and accommodating. price of my sandwich + tax + tip felt a little high but they don’t skimp on the bacon etc on it so it feels like a fair trade for some tasty calories. have had the coffee, here, too and that was decent for deli coffee. all in all a good spot when you don’t want to cook!
